Property management firms that rip off leaseholders could be banned under Labour
Briefly

Property management companies would be banned from operating in England and Wales if they persistently ripped off leaseholders, under plans being considered by Labour.Lisa Nandy, the shadow housing secretary, is looking at proposals to clamp down on the sector, amid complaints from leaseholders about escalating fees and essential maintenance being left undone.
